Puck Pieterse Triumphs in World Cup Debut with Impressive Win over Ferrand-Prevot in Nove Mesto
Puck Pieterse had a dream World Cup debut in Nove Mesto, Czech Republic, as she dominated the women’s under-23 category and beat 2015 world champion Pauline Ferrand-Prevot on her way to the top step of the podium. With an outstanding performance, the Dutch rider proved that she has what it takes to compete with the best on the international stage.
It All Started with a Solid Start Loop
Pieterse started strong and rode in the front group from the beginning. She completed the start loop in 6th place and soon found herself in the lead with Ferrand-Prevot and Swiss rider Jacqueline Schneebeli. She attacked on the second lap and managed to create a gap, which she never relinquished throughout the race.
A Commanding Performance
The 19-year-old rider showed incredible strength and composure as she tackled the challenging course, which included several technical descents and steep climbs. She rode smoothly and confidently, and her lead grew with every lap, eventually crossing the line with a comfortable margin of 46 seconds over Ferrand-Prevot.
